Ibogawa (揖保川町 Ibogawa-chō?) was a town located in Ibo District, Hyōgo, Japan.

As of 2003, the town had an estimated population of 12,898 and a density of 545.14 persons per km². The total area was 23.66 km².

On October 1, 2005 Ibogawa, along with the towns of Mitsu and Shingū, all from Ibo District, was merged into the expanded city of Tatsuno.
